Transaction aed56bf0d709628103dbff05965c9449ebc3adfb9520e7e903b5778716098d1a

1 Input
2 Outputs
  • aed56bf0d709628103dbff05965c9449ebc3adfb9520e7e903b5778716098d1a:0
  • value  622068
    address  398kxEpnyisme6DuoPAVYxSm1TfFMM7jAi
  • aed56bf0d709628103dbff05965c9449ebc3adfb9520e7e903b5778716098d1a:1
  • value  8352060
    address  3FX2u7HtYb6duLosLWYUrF2EXLtPxnehaX